Re: Need help urgently - Replication ERROR 18456



Paul we are not using a domain model instead we use independent
servers, but I tried to do what you suggested. I verified that the
same account name runs the SQL Agent on each server and reset their
passwords to the same value. I then restarted the SQL Agent(s). I
also reset the password for the SQL login 'mac', on all three servers,
to the same value.

I then tried setting up replication and received the same ERROR 18456
(login failed for user mac). I still don't understand why the login
fails for user 'mac' when I am configuring replication with my login
'war'. 'mac' is a SQL login as is 'war'. ANY IDEAS?
